I've had this problem for some time and have yet to find an answer.
Maybe some of the linux peeps can advise.

UT runs great on my Mandrake 9.2 install in a local game, very high
frame rates when playing offline. Yet, if I play online, my frame
rates are locked in at 50 fps, no matter what netspeed setting. I
have ut2k3 running under linux also, and it has the same odd FPS cap
when playing online. Does anyone else see this? Is there some
setting that affects this phenomenon or is it a Linux system tick rate
issue?

Have you tried putting the setting there nonetheless? One of the people
in that thread also said the setting was missing in UT2k3, but still
putting it in the ini file an setting it to false works.
